Brasil quilombo

Synopsis:

The first settlements of the slaves that arrived to Brazil and managed to flee and live in freedom are still stuck in the past. Their houses made of adobe and cane and their rudimentary farm tools are testaments to that fact. This documentary narrates the living conditions in one of these settlements where it seems time has stood still.
